Nvidia GPU chipset problems affect Dell laptop line

What was previously reported as an issue contained to HP laptops, has now been linked to 10 Dell models. Nvidia had acknowledged that certain GPUs are suffering from high failure rates when undergoing “temperature fluctuations”. The problem stems from a weak die/packaging material set.

While Nvidia is dealing with their supply chain problems, Dell has provided a list of affected notebooks and recommends that you flash your system BIOS as a preventive measure. The BIOS updates, found here, are designed to reduce the likelihood of GPU failure.

[[[UPDATE 8/2/08: THE BIOS UPGRADE MIGHT NOT BE IN YOUR BEST INTEREST, AND MAY NOT BE REVERSIBLE. SEEMS IT MOSTLY JUST TURNS THE FAN ON ALL THE TIME. GOOD FOR THEM, BAD FOR YOU.]]]
